Privacy-First Communication
Collaboration tools have evolved rapidly, but security has lagged behind. Most business video systems intercept and process data on their server nodes, leaving communications vulnerable to surveillance, data breaches, and logging.
Foxcolab Meet changes that framework entirely. By leveraging peer-to-peer and edge selective forwarding technology backed by mathematical zero-knowledge authentication, we guarantee that only active participants hold keys to decapsulate calls.
Zero Trust Infrastructure
We operate on the assumption that the network and server nodes are compromised. Encryption is applied at the origin and decrypted only at the recipient's endpoint.
Decentralized Control
Organizations control their policies and storage endpoints. Data stays in the region chosen by the account administrator, compliant with local privacy acts.
